CMT Capital Markets Trading's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, CMT Capital Markets Trading held 162 positions worth $4.03B, up 3.7% from $3.89B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 58% of the portfolio.

CMT Capital Markets Trading withdrew a net $299M in Q2 2018, closing 8 positions and reducing 69 holdings. Its most notable exit was Netflix, an estimated $12.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 1% of assets, up from 0.36%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, CMT Capital Markets Trading opened a new position in Salesforce worth $17.3M.
